首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Java swing应用程序中更改字体样式和大小

在Java Swing应用程序中更改字体样式和大小可以通过以下步骤完成:

  1. 导入所需的类和包:在代码的开头,使用import语句导入javax.swingjava.awt相关类。
  2. 创建 Swing 组件:创建需要更改字体样式和大小的 Swing 组件,如 JLabelJButtonJTextField 等。
  3. 创建字体对象:使用java.awt.Font类创建一个新的字体对象,指定字体的名称、样式(例如粗体、斜体)和大小。
  4. 设置字体:将创建的字体对象应用到需要更改字体样式和大小的 Swing 组件上,通过调用组件的 setFont() 方法来实现。

下面是一个简单的示例代码,演示如何在 Java Swing 应用程序中更改字体样式和大小:

代码语言:txt
复制
import javax.swing.*;
import java.awt.*;

public class FontExample {
    public static void main(String[] args) {
        // 创建 Swing 窗口
        JFrame frame = new JFrame("Font Example");
        fr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
        frame.setSize(300, 200);

        // 创建标签组件
        JLabel label = new JLabel("Hello, World!");

        // 创建字体对象
        Font font = new Font("Arial", Font.BOLD, 20);

        // 设置字体
        label.setFont(font);

        // 将标签添加到窗口中
        frame.getContentPane().add(label);

        // 显示窗口
        frame.setVisible(true);
    }
}

在上面的示例中,我们创建了一个 JLabel 标签组件,并使用 new Font("Arial", Font.BOLD, 20) 创建了一个 Arial 字体的粗体样式,并将字体大小设置为 20。然后,我们通过调用 label.setFont(font) 方法将字体应用到标签组件上。最后,将标签添加到窗口中,并显示窗口。

这是一个简单的例子,用于演示如何在 Java Swing 应用程序中更改字体样式和大小。在实际应用中,您可以根据需要进行更多的自定义和调整。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券